116 Commits

Author SHA1 Message Date
Felix Roos
6f2e026e4a
fix: import in vitest config 2025-05-01 23:49:47 +02:00
Alex McLean
0925ea56dd
Allow wchooseCycles probabilities to be patterned (#1292)
* allow wchooseCycles probabilities to be patterned
2025-02-23 09:52:27 +00:00
Felix Roos
5a188f7461
cleanup 2025-01-26 15:50:44 +01:00
Felix Roos
3e721d91a5
update all the things again 2025-01-26 14:51:08 +01:00
Felix Roos
c7cd03a2aa
migrate eslint 2025-01-26 13:24:51 +01:00
Felix Roos
1b8ccc05e1
update main package + core package + vite / vitest 2025-01-24 15:45:49 +01:00
Felix Roos
e3a3c0c5f9 Revert "failing to upgrade eslint"
This reverts commit 67964c7e23c820478b80e48a648f55c0a71247fe.
2024-10-19 00:56:55 +02:00
Felix Roos
67964c7e23 failing to upgrade eslint 2024-10-19 00:31:52 +02:00
Felix Roos
9e5f9d37ef update vitest from 1 to 2 2024-10-18 23:45:54 +02:00
Felix Roos
0c1234a35f update minor versions 2024-10-18 23:38:35 +02:00
Alex McLean
e47d67a9da
Benchmarks (#1079)
* tactus-oriented benchmarks
* add benchmarks for individual example tunes
2024-05-03 10:52:56 +01:00
Felix Roos
ff923a6b6e remove starting sampler by default 2024-03-30 16:02:02 +01:00
Felix Roos
22774596ca run sampler in parallel by default + move samples folder to root 2024-03-30 04:48:55 +01:00
Felix Roos
8f355dcf96 add sampler script + samples folder with README 2024-03-30 04:42:45 +01:00
Felix Roos
fc32981886 update undocumented script 2024-03-23 14:08:02 +01:00
Felix Roos
4511732252 remove canvas dependency 2024-03-21 08:35:44 +01:00
Felix Roos
96bafa7f0b the big rename: @strudel.cycles/* -> @strudel/* 2024-01-18 09:54:37 +01:00
Felix Roos
45eed1b7e7 fix: for some reason, ci fails without it... 2023-12-31 00:58:09 +01:00
Felix Roos
b36d334f78 fix: duplicate pretest 2023-12-31 00:56:38 +01:00
Felix Roos
b52f8c2925 update remaining packages 2023-12-31 00:41:06 +01:00
Felix Roos
59ce624521 update webmidi + codemirror 2023-12-31 00:34:55 +01:00
Felix Roos
74b9279416 update eslint 2023-12-31 00:03:45 +01:00
Felix Roos
4f5ca0767d updates... 2023-12-30 23:50:30 +01:00
Felix Roos
7db684e308 update lerna 2023-12-30 23:19:22 +01:00
Felix Roos
1981e1c34c update dependency-tree + prettier
+ rerun undocumented script
2023-12-30 23:15:44 +01:00
Felix Roos
6f68bdcf5b update vite + astro 2023-12-30 23:08:15 +01:00
Alexandre Gravel-Raymond
d71877f915 Move jsdoc files to subfolder 2023-11-22 20:35:19 +01:00
Felix Roos
af915be142 replace strudel.tidalcycles.org with strudel.cc 2023-10-28 23:49:30 +02:00
Felix Roos
ce820c2314 update vitest 2023-07-17 23:37:51 +02:00
vvm
6f41716ab5 init 2023-06-23 21:06:10 +04:00
Daria Cotocu
b63f4eb503 Update solmization.test.js 2023-05-24 18:58:11 +01:00
Felix Roos
602bfbdd79 update a bunch of minor versions 2023-04-30 08:20:51 +02:00
Felix Roos
0785bdd37a update lerna 2023-04-30 08:04:56 +02:00
Felix Roos
d1c8ebd15b remove c8 2023-04-30 07:55:23 +02:00
Felix Roos
13088e4001 - remove gh-pages
- update peggy
- rebuild parser
2023-04-30 07:48:08 +02:00
Felix Roos
0fcec0a0ca upgrade jsdoc 2023-04-28 13:05:50 +02:00
Felix Roos
2bdcfe13e6 update @vitest/ui 2023-04-28 12:20:35 +02:00
Felix Roos
dc6c29c668 update vitest to ^0.28.0 2023-04-28 12:08:48 +02:00
Felix Roos
b9ca9d3b06 update lerna 2023-03-23 11:17:21 +01:00
Felix Roos
7ac0cdc0f9 fix: lint error 2023-02-25 14:18:23 +01:00
Felix Roos
aa5dd7920f organize tasks 2023-02-01 20:38:56 +01:00
Felix Roos
d60956e82a update contribution guide to pnpm
+ update root tasks
2023-02-01 20:33:13 +01:00
Felix Roos
84bf4a2686 add pretest 2023-01-30 22:53:53 +01:00
Felix Roos
cfaecf9fcb migrate lerna to pnpm
https://lerna.js.org/docs/recipes/using-pnpm-with-lerna
2023-01-28 22:01:35 +01:00
Felix Roos
902f722d4c add import linting + fix checks 2023-01-28 21:00:42 +01:00
Felix Roos
35f2040717 use pnpm workspaces 2023-01-28 20:14:26 +01:00
Felix Roos
68cc109933 burn down that undocumented list 2023-01-12 17:25:01 +01:00
Felix Roos
19982a2ffb remove unused package 2023-01-12 13:00:22 +01:00
Felix Roos
48d0ffe868 add script that finds all undocumented exports 2023-01-12 12:35:04 +01:00
Felix Roos
a675815529 hotfix: preview command + build peg without logs 2023-01-09 23:55:45 +01:00